How Heat-Reducing Window Film Works

Heat-reducing window film is a specially engineered layer applied to interior or exterior glass surfaces. It reflects a significant portion of solar heat and blocks harmful UV rays while still allowing natural light to pass through. For buildings with expansive windows or sun-facing offices, this film helps prevent indoor temperatures from spiking during peak sunlight hours.

Example:
An office tower with floor-to-ceiling windows may suffer from uneven temperature zones, where some rooms are noticeably hotter than others. After applying commercial tinting with heat-reducing film, indoor temperatures stabilize, and the HVAC system doesn’t have to work as hard—resulting in noticeable energy savings.

How Commercial Tinting Works

Commercial tinting operates through the application of specialized films to windows, which effectively enhances energy efficiency by controlling the amount of solar radiation that enters a building. These films are composed of multiple layers of polyester, metalized coatings, and adhesives that are engineered to reflect, absorb, and transmit varying degrees of solar energy. The metalized coatings, often made of materials such as aluminum or silver, play a vital role in reflecting infrared radiation, thereby reducing heat gain within the building.

The installation process requires meticulous surface preparation to guarantee maximum adhesion and longevity of the film. Technicians begin by cleaning the window surface to remove any contaminants that could hinder the adhesive properties of the film. Once the surface is prepared, the film is carefully applied using a squeegee to eliminate air pockets and secure a seamless bond with the glass.

Performance metrics such as Visible Light Transmission (VLT), Solar Heat Gain Coefficient (SHGC), and U-value are essential in evaluating the effectiveness of commercial tinting films. These parameters help in selecting the appropriate film based on specific energy efficiency goals and building requirements. Understanding these technical specifications is crucial for optimizing the building’s thermal performance and achieving desired energy savings.

Choosing the Right Tint

Choosing the right tint for a commercial property necessitates a thorough understanding of various factors to achieve peak performance and compliance with industry standards. Key considerations include Visible Light Transmission (VLT), Solar Heat Gain Coefficient (SHGC), and Ultraviolet (UV) rejection rates.

VLT measures the amount of visible light passing through the window, influencing both interior lighting and glare reduction. SHGC assesses the fraction of solar radiation admitted through the window, directly impacting HVAC load and energy efficiency. Higher UV rejection rates protect interior furnishings and occupants from harmful UV rays, extending the lifespan of materials and promoting occupant health.

Moreover, the type of glass substrate, existing glazing systems, and local building codes must be taken into account. Dual-pane windows, for instance, may necessitate spectrally selective films to uphold thermal insulation properties while enhancing solar control.

Industry certifications, such as those from the International Window Film Association (IWFA) and National Fenestration Rating Council (NFRC), ensure that selected tints meet rigorous performance criteria.

Choosing the Right Tinting Solution

To fully leverage the energy efficiency benefits of commercial tinting, selecting the appropriate tinting solution is pivotal. The right choice hinges on various factors, including solar heat gain coefficient (SHGC), visible light transmission (VLT), and ultraviolet (UV) protection. These criteria collectively influence the thermal performance, visual comfort, and longevity of office buildings.

  1. Solar Heat Gain Coefficient (SHGC): SHGC measures how well the tinting film blocks heat from sunlight. A lower SHGC indicates better heat reduction, essential for minimizing air conditioning loads and enhancing energy efficiency.
  2. Visible Light Transmission (VLT): VLT quantifies the percentage of visible light that passes through the tinting film. Striking the right balance is crucial; too high a VLT may lead to excessive glare, while too low can result in an overly dim interior, necessitating additional artificial lighting.
  3. Ultraviolet (UV) Protection: Effective UV protection is crucial for safeguarding office interiors from harmful UV rays, which can cause fading of furnishings and contribute to skin health risks. Films with high UV rejection rates extend the lifespan of interior assets and improve occupant well-being.
